Why weren't SpearSwords more common? by DOVAHBOIIreal in SWORDS

[–]DemonFire75 3 points4 points  (0 children)

Its because the way you use a spear when stopping a cavalry charge wouldn't be by just holding it your hands you'd put he butt end/ spike of the halft into the ground then plant one foot on top of that or kneel beside it and hold the spear with both hands, it would mean the force of the charging horse would be transferred to the ground rather than tearing the spear from your grip, you've also got to keep in mind that spears/ pikes especially in a war setting against cavalry were cheap and wasn't just one guy it would be a whole group that would would likely outnumber the cavalry for a fraction of the cost in armour, weapons training etc. So even if you get the spear torn from your hands trying to stop a charge you likely have 2 or more people beside you aiming for the horse/ rider as well

Why do Terminators use Storm Bolters as a standard weapon? by Ridingwood333 in 40kLore

[–]DemonFire75 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Yes the bolter is relatively ineffective against space marines because they're the exception not the rule, 90% of the enemies of the imperium are highly vulnerable to bolter fire, the bolters rounds are essentially miniature rockets which can fly over relatively long distances. The default explosive payload rounds they carry is so effective because the round bores into the target and then detonates meaning anything that's got any kind of fleshy weak spot is going to suffer, Orks and Nids are reduced to piles of wet mulch by them and aeldar/ drucari footsoldiers don't have armour tough enough to resist the sheer impact of them. Daemons can be killed with relative ease as they generally lack armour and the specialised rounds the grey knights use for them means they certainly can kill daemons.

You also have to keep in mind that unlike the stubber the bolter can use specialised rounds designed for certain targets, the deathwatch have invented at least 3 for certain types of xenos and the grey knights as I mentioned before have ones particularly effective against daemons

The main thing that the bolter struggles to deal with are chaos space marines but a heavy stubber wouldnt be any more effective against them either and chaos marines are way less common to encounter than any other enemy in the 40k universe so if you do meet one that's when you break out the meltas or plasma guns
